Ha Giang - Tam Son - Dong Van Global Karst Plateau (135km)
Dong Van Karst Plateau Geopark - 8:30 am: The team will pick up guests from their hotels or homestays around Ha Giang city to begin the renowned Ha Giang loop.
- 9:00 am: Depart the city, enjoying the mountain views and tranquil villages.
- 10:00 am: Enter the Dong Van Global Karst Plateau Geopark (Vietnam’s first Geopark) and stop at the top of Bac Sum Pass, the initial pass leading into the Geopark.
- 11:00 am: Arrive at Quan Ba Heaven Gate, the highest point of the day at 1500m above sea level, and take a coffee break with a stunning panoramic view of the mountains.
- 12:00-1:30 pm: Drive to Yen Minh Town, enjoying the mountain views along the way.
- 1:30 pm: Take a lunch break in Yen Minh town.
- 2:30 pm: After lunch, continue on the road to Sa Phin village to visit the Vuong ancient house (Hmong King palace).
- 5:00 pm: Head to Dong Van town.
- 6:00 pm: Check in at the hotel or homestay in town, and enjoy a leisurely walk around Dong Van ancient town.
- 7:30 pm: Dinner time, savor local foods and conclude the day with some happy water.
Dong Van - Ma Pi Leng Pass - Du Gia Village (90km)
Dong Van - 8:30 am: Enjoy breakfast in town with mountain views (visit the largest local market in Dong Van if visiting on a Sunday).
- 9:00 am: Get back on the bike, leave town, and drive down to Nho Que River for a 1.5-hour boat trip through Tu San Canyon (the deepest canyon in Southeast Asia).
- 11:30 am: Return to the road and head to Ma Pi Leng Pass (one of Vietnam’s four most beautiful passes).
- 1:00 pm: Take a lunch break in Meo Vac town.
- 2:30 pm: Continue the journey to Du Gia village, stopping at Sa Li Pass to view the Dao villages and rice terraces from above.
- 5:30 pm: Arrive at Du Gia village, check in at the Tay people’s homestay, and relax in the peaceful village.
- 7:30 pm: Enjoy a family dinner and fall asleep to traditional music.
Du Gia Village - Ha Giang City (120km)
Nho Que River - 8:00 am: Have breakfast with mountain views.
- 8:30 am: Hit the road and visit Du Gia waterfall.
- 9:30 am: Continue the journey to Ha Giang city, passing beautiful Hmong villages with several photo opportunities along the way.
- 12:00 pm: Visit Lung Tam village to learn about the ancient art of Hemp weaving from the Hmong people.
- 1:30 pm: Take a lunch break in Nam Dam village (a cultural village of the Dao people).
- 2:30 pm: Travel 45km back to Ha Giang city.
- 5:00 pm: Arrive at the city viewpoint for a panoramic view of the city (enjoy a final beer or coffee with the team after the tour).
- 5:30 pm: Conclude the tour at your hotel, homestay, or the bus station.
